"EuroTec 2016"
Yes it's back!

Image

This event is taking place across the weekend of Fri 15th and Sat 16th July 2016 in Norfolk (And Thursday 14th if you want too!).

As with the highly successful sell-out EuroTec events in 2006, 2007, 2008, 2009, 2010 ,2011, 2012 and 2015, not to mention the other so-called "mini-meets" this will be based in the pretty county of Norfolk, this time at a new location, still close to the Royal Family's home at Sandringham.
For pictures of our previous events please click here

Image

The hotel (same as the October and March mini-meets) is http://ffolkes-arms-hotel.co.uk/ . Accommodation is not exactly 5 star, but it's quiet, and has a huge tarmac car park. There are 20 rooms in total.

Follow this event on Facebook!: Image

Attendance at these events is always high, always sells out, and up to 30 DeLorean cars are expected this time.

As with the previous big events here, this will be a guaranteed sell-out, and the best rooms will be allocated in booking order. The entire hotel (20 rooms) has been blocked booked for this event's exclusive use. Strong interest has already been shown again for this event, as before there is NO charge for the event itself, just the cost of food, drink and accommodation. Previous years have been attended by 30-40 DeLoreans. Due to the size of this hotel (20 rooms) I doubt that will be the case this time, since we can't fit everyone in the rooms. For those that don't book in time we will be utilising "overflow hotels" again.

The basis of the weekend will be around 'Workshop / Tech sessions' throughout the weekend, as well as socialising and meeting new faces. As before we will take over the bar for the weekend :wink:

Many more 'activities' are planned, details to follow.

As before we will be arranging a scenic drive and other activities over the weekend (mainly on the Saturday) - more to be announced later. There will be plenty of entertainment throughout the weekend, with something for everyone. As usual, the main organisers will be Arran, Alistair and Nick T.

This is a good way to meet up with like minded people and swap tips. For non-owners there will be more time to ask questions, look around the cars, etc.


The Itinerary:
- Option to arrive Thursday from 14:00 onwards.
- Arrive Friday from 14:00 onwards.
- Socialise, congratulate those who've braved the Norfolk roads in their DeLoreans
- Buffet style dinner 7:45pm (£15 per head)
- Beer etc. (a late bar has been arranged)
- Sleep
- Saturday - Breakfast (included)
- Hang around car park kicking tyres, etc.
- t.b.c.
- 1.30 Lunch at "Arbuckles", local large popular restaurant nearby
- 3.00 Tech session
- Bar
- Buffet style dinner - 7:45pm (£15 per head)
- Beer etc. (a late bar has been arranged)
- t.b.c. entertainment
- Sleep
- Sunday - Breakfast (included)
- Go home

Room prices including breakfast:
Single: £45 per night
Double/Twin: £65 per ROOM per night (£32.50 per person per night)
Family of 3: £80 per ROOM per night
Family of 4: £90 per ROOM per night

Food prices:
Friday night - £15
Saturday lunch - up to you :)
Saturday night - £15

So a typical couple staying for 2 nights can expect to pay under £100 each total including all 5 meals (plus drinks). Yes I know it's cheap! :D


If you would like to come along for just the day on Saturday only then you're more than welcome - you'll just have to pay for lunch if you want it.
If you would like to come along for either evening meal without staying then it would be £15 per person for either night.
